Gatsby Gets the Green Light
Hometown: Westminster
Current members: Rory Pettingill, vocals; Trevor Simpson, guitar and vocals; Andrew Cohen, bass and vocals; Matt Galler, drums
Founded in: 2005
Style: pop rock
Influenced by: the Mars Volta, the Academy Is, Treos
Notable: While recording their debut EP Choose Your Own Adventure, band members added extra overdubs. To re-create the full sound live, they played tracks off a laptop until it was stolen on a recent tour stop in Nashville. Now, they've downgraded to an iPod but want to keep using the pre-recorded drum tracks and other instrumentation in their shows.
Quotable: Simpson on playing with the iPod: "It definitely has made us on the whole a much tighter musical unit. The
benefits way outweigh the drawbacks. It's more for a matter of professionalism and being able to play with a computer. I
wish we had the money to hire an orchestra or something like that, but until then, we have a computer."
